Transaction e4868c5a9b7bb6c5f70f2704cd4b81527de40566cbb50f3de3c32e21117683aa
1 Input
1 Output
-
e4868c5a9b7bb6c5f70f2704cd4b81527de40566cbb50f3de3c32e21117683aa:0
- value
- 914239
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de7062358220a9afdce3a27459d55d1f23afec1d OP_EQUAL
- address
- 3MyAZgUxVdWf2xm9CRaakWtJjNFJW95mta